= Strategy =
= Strategy =


Powerful possession with an exert-to-wound ability. Direct wounding is an envied ability to target powerful minions (Such as {{Card|Orthanc Champion}}), to wound minions with powerful exert-to-play abilities (Such as {{Card|Ulaire Enquea, Lieutenant of Morgul}}), or to kill low-vitality minions to prevent a swarm of minions (like {{C|Moria}} or {{C|Dunland}}). With {{Card|The Sage of Elendil}}, it's possible to kill minions with 4 vitality, potentially making a double move viable.

Decks that feature Aragorn's Bow often prioritize healing (such as {{Card|Elrond, Herald to Gil-galad}} or {{Card|Might of Numenor}}) as Aragorn could create a lot of exertions with his ability. Aragorn's Bow is also often seen in conjunction with other directed wounding (such as {{Card|Greenleaf}}; {{Card|Rumil, Elven Protector}}, or {{Card|Orophin, Lorien Bowman}}) as well as in mass archery decks, but he can also be used effectively with Maneuver wounding (such as {{Card|Defend It and Hope}}, {{Card|Quick As May Be}}, or {{Card|Terrible and Evil}}) or skirmish phase wounding (such as {{Card|Lady of Ithilien}} or {{Card|Power According to His Stature}}).

The direct wounding capability of Aragorn bearing Aragorn's Bow creates a natural synergy with {{Card|Third Marshal of Riddermark}} and similar Rohan strategies relating to wounds (such as {{Card|We Left None Alive}} or {{Card|Elite Rider}}). Natural synergy also exists with {{C|Gandalf}} and {{Card|1C85}}.
